Home
last modified time | relevance | path

Searched refs:asic_ops (Results 1 – 6 of 6) sorted by relevance

/drivers/gpu/drm/amd/amdkfd/
Dkfd_device_queue_manager_cik.c46 struct device_queue_manager_asic_ops *asic_ops) in device_queue_manager_init_cik() argument
48 asic_ops->set_cache_memory_policy = set_cache_memory_policy_cik; in device_queue_manager_init_cik()
49 asic_ops->update_qpd = update_qpd_cik; in device_queue_manager_init_cik()
50 asic_ops->init_sdma_vm = init_sdma_vm; in device_queue_manager_init_cik()
51 asic_ops->mqd_manager_init = mqd_manager_init_cik; in device_queue_manager_init_cik()
55 struct device_queue_manager_asic_ops *asic_ops) in device_queue_manager_init_cik_hawaii() argument
57 asic_ops->set_cache_memory_policy = set_cache_memory_policy_cik; in device_queue_manager_init_cik_hawaii()
58 asic_ops->update_qpd = update_qpd_cik_hawaii; in device_queue_manager_init_cik_hawaii()
59 asic_ops->init_sdma_vm = init_sdma_vm_hawaii; in device_queue_manager_init_cik_hawaii()
60 asic_ops->mqd_manager_init = mqd_manager_init_cik_hawaii; in device_queue_manager_init_cik_hawaii()
Dkfd_device_queue_manager_vi.c52 struct device_queue_manager_asic_ops *asic_ops) in device_queue_manager_init_vi() argument
54 asic_ops->set_cache_memory_policy = set_cache_memory_policy_vi; in device_queue_manager_init_vi()
55 asic_ops->update_qpd = update_qpd_vi; in device_queue_manager_init_vi()
56 asic_ops->init_sdma_vm = init_sdma_vm; in device_queue_manager_init_vi()
57 asic_ops->mqd_manager_init = mqd_manager_init_vi; in device_queue_manager_init_vi()
61 struct device_queue_manager_asic_ops *asic_ops) in device_queue_manager_init_vi_tonga() argument
63 asic_ops->set_cache_memory_policy = set_cache_memory_policy_vi_tonga; in device_queue_manager_init_vi_tonga()
64 asic_ops->update_qpd = update_qpd_vi_tonga; in device_queue_manager_init_vi_tonga()
65 asic_ops->init_sdma_vm = init_sdma_vm_tonga; in device_queue_manager_init_vi_tonga()
66 asic_ops->mqd_manager_init = mqd_manager_init_vi_tonga; in device_queue_manager_init_vi_tonga()
Dkfd_device_queue_manager.h169 struct device_queue_manager_asic_ops asic_ops; member
204 struct device_queue_manager_asic_ops *asic_ops);
206 struct device_queue_manager_asic_ops *asic_ops);
208 struct device_queue_manager_asic_ops *asic_ops);
210 struct device_queue_manager_asic_ops *asic_ops);
212 struct device_queue_manager_asic_ops *asic_ops);
214 struct device_queue_manager_asic_ops *asic_ops);
Dkfd_device_queue_manager_v10.c35 struct device_queue_manager_asic_ops *asic_ops) in device_queue_manager_init_v10_navi10() argument
37 asic_ops->update_qpd = update_qpd_v10; in device_queue_manager_init_v10_navi10()
38 asic_ops->init_sdma_vm = init_sdma_vm_v10; in device_queue_manager_init_v10_navi10()
39 asic_ops->mqd_manager_init = mqd_manager_init_v10; in device_queue_manager_init_v10_navi10()
Dkfd_device_queue_manager_v9.c36 struct device_queue_manager_asic_ops *asic_ops) in device_queue_manager_init_v9() argument
38 asic_ops->update_qpd = update_qpd_v9; in device_queue_manager_init_v9()
39 asic_ops->init_sdma_vm = init_sdma_vm_v9; in device_queue_manager_init_v9()
40 asic_ops->mqd_manager_init = mqd_manager_init_v9; in device_queue_manager_init_v9()
Dkfd_device_queue_manager.c369 dqm->asic_ops.init_sdma_vm(dqm, q, qpd); in create_queue_nocpsch()
903 retval = dqm->asic_ops.update_qpd(dqm, qpd); in register_process()
1326 dqm->asic_ops.init_sdma_vm(dqm, q, qpd); in create_queue_cpsch()
1596 if (!dqm->asic_ops.set_cache_memory_policy) in set_cache_memory_policy()
1629 retval = dqm->asic_ops.set_cache_memory_policy( in set_cache_memory_policy()
1813 mqd_mgr = dqm->asic_ops.mqd_manager_init(i, dqm->dev); in init_mqd_managers()
1925 device_queue_manager_init_vi(&dqm->asic_ops); in device_queue_manager_init()
1929 device_queue_manager_init_cik(&dqm->asic_ops); in device_queue_manager_init()
1933 device_queue_manager_init_cik_hawaii(&dqm->asic_ops); in device_queue_manager_init()
1942 device_queue_manager_init_vi_tonga(&dqm->asic_ops); in device_queue_manager_init()
[all …]